Evolution of a Rising Lightweight Contender

Myktybek Orolbai has rapidly earned a reputation as a relentless grappler with a rapidly maturing striking game. His transition into the UFC was marked by a clinical performance that signaled his intent to compete with the division's elite. Unlike many prospects who rely on one-dimensional skill sets, Orolbai brings a distinct brand of high-pressure wrestling coupled with heavy-handed volume that forces opponents into uncomfortable positions early in the bout.

His development in 2026 has been defined by his integration into world-class training environments. By sharpening his defensive wrestling and tightening his submission transitions, Orolbai is addressing the necessary gaps that separate regional standouts from title challengers. His recent activity indicates a fighter who is not merely looking for a payday, but is systematically dismantling the opposition to build a resume worthy of a main card placement. The lightweight division is arguably the deepest in the sport, and Orolbai's ability to maintain high output across fifteen minutes is what currently differentiates his tactical approach from his contemporaries.
